KAYAK's insights & trends for Kolkata to Southeast Asia flights

Get data-powered insights and trends into fl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ia to help you find the cheapest flights, the best time to fly, and much more.

What is the cheapest Kolkata to Southeast Asia flight route?

Data is based on round-trip flight searches on KAYAK over the past month.

The cheapest ticket to Southeast Asia from Kolkata found in the last 72 hours was to Bangkok, at ₹ 11,519 return. The most popular route is from Kolkata (CCU) to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port (BKK), and the cheapest round-trip airline ticket found on this route in the last 3 days was ₹ 11,519.

What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Southeast Asia?

The average price for all round-trip fl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ia depending on the time of departure, clicked by users on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

The cheapest time of day to fly to Southeast Asia is generally at night, when retur flights cost ₹ 20,259 on average. Morning departures are around 5%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Southeast Asia is generally in the evening,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is ₹ 27,306.

Can I save money by flying with a stopover from Kolkata to Southeast Asia?

The average return price for all direct flights, flights with one stopover, and flights with two stopov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

No, with an average price for the route of ₹ 19,055, prices are generally cheapest when you fly direct.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Kolkata to Southeast Asia?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ia is August, when tickets cost ₹ 4,014 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and January, when the average cost of return tickets is ₹ 55,146 and ₹ 53,616 respectively.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Kolkata to Southeast Asia?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If your flying dates are flexible, you should consider flying to Southeast Asia on a Tuesday, as we generally find the cheapest rates on that day for this route. On the other hand, Friday is the most expensive day to fly from Kolkata to Southeast Asia. For your return ticket, we recommend flying on a Wednesday and avoiding Tuesdays for the best deals.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Kolkata to Southeast Asia?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below-average price on a flight from Kolkata to Southeast Asia,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 25% compared to booking last-min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 22 weeks before departure.

FAQs - booking Southeast Asia flights

  • How does KAYAK find such low prices on fl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ia?

    KAYAK is a travel search engine. That means we look across the web to find the best prices we can find for our users. With over 2 billion flight queries processed yearly, we are able to display a variety of prices and options on fl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ia.

  • How does KAYAK's flight Price Forecast tool help me choose the right time to buy my flight ticket from Kolkata to Southeast Asia?

    KAYAK’s flight Price Forecast tool uses historical data to determine whether the price for a flight from Kolkata to Southeast Asia is likely to change within 7 days, so travellers know whether to wait or book now.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Kolkata to Southeast Asia?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Kolkata to Southeast Asia with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Kolkata to Southeast Asia?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from Kolkata to Southeast Asia up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
